Windows 7 не видит других компьютеров в сети: причины и решения
- Windows 7 не видит другие компьютеры в сети: причины и решения
- Основные причины, почему Windows 7 не видит сетевой компьютер
- Практические решения проблемы
- Настройка сетевого обнаружения и общего доступа в Windows 7 для видимости компьютеров
- Включение сетевого обнаружения
- Настройка общего доступа с защитой паролем
- Проверка службы обнаружения SSDP и функции 'Обнаружение по сети'
- Настройка общего доступа к конкретным папкам
- Влияние параметров брандмауэра и антивируса на видимость сетевых устройств в Windows 7
- Основные настройки брандмауэра Windows 7, влияющие на видимость в сети
- Влияние антивирусных программ и их защитных модулей
- Практические рекомендации и советы
Иногда возникает ситуация, когда ПК на базе Windows 7 упорно отказывается отображать другие компьютеры, подключённые к той же локальной сети. Это может быть вызвано разными настройками, начиная от параметров общего доступа и заканчивая конфликтами в сетевых службах. Если вам знакома подобная проблема и хочется понять, с чего начинать поиск решения, в этой статье мы подробно разберём ключевые причины, которые мешают вашему компьютеру обнаруживать соседние устройства в сети. Для более полного понимания советую сразу посмотреть видео в начале статьи и не пропустить ролик в конце – там все нюансы раскрыты максимально наглядно и понятно.
Windows 7 не видит другие компьютеры в сети: причины и решения
Очень важно разобраться в нюансах настройки сети, чтобы правильно устранить неполадки. Если windows 7 не видит компьютеры в сети, причины могут крыться в нескольких основных точках: сетевой профиль, параметры общего доступа, фаервол, службы и настройки протоколов. Ниже рассмотрим наиболее часто возникающие проблемы и практические рекомендации их решения.
Основные причины, почему Windows 7 не видит сетевой компьютер
- Неправильный сетевой профиль. В Windows 7 сеть может быть помечена как «Общественная» или «Домашняя/Рабочая». Если выбран «Общественный» профиль, компьютер ограничивает доступ к ресурсам и отключает автоматическое обнаружение других устройств. Чтобы исправить, нужно перейти в Центр управления сетями и общим доступом, изменить тип сети на «Домашняя» или «Рабочая» и убедиться, что включено сетевое обнаружение.
- Отключённое сетевое обнаружение и общий доступ. В настройках общего доступа должна быть активирована опция «Включить сетевое обнаружение» и «Включить общий доступ к файлам и принтерам». Без этих настроек windows 7 не видит других компьютеров в сети даже при правильных типах профиля.
- Проблемы с протоколом SMB. Windows 7 использует протокол SMB версии 1 или 2 для обмена данными. Если этот протокол отключён, что иногда происходит после обновлений или в целях безопасности, увидеть другие компьютеры в сети не получится. Проверьте компоненты Windows и убедитесь, что «Поддержка общего доступа к файлам и принтерам SMB» включена в разделе «Протоколы» в свойствах сетевого подключения.
- Брандмауэр Windows или сторонние фаерволы. Часто проблемы с обнаружением сетевых компьютеров связаны с блокировкой портов и служб фаерволом. Для проверки временно отключите брандмауэр и убедитесь, что компьютеры появляются в сетевом окружении. Если после отключения проблема исчезает, нужно внести исключения для служб: «Обнаружение SSDP», «UPnP» и разрешить входящие подключения для протокола SMB и NetBIOS.
- Проблемы с сетевыми службами. Для корректного отображения и обнаружения компьютеров в сети должны работать службы: «Публикация ресурсов обнаружения функций», «Узел обнаружения функций» и «Хост провайдера обнаружения функций». Иногда эти службы могут быть остановлены или иметь неправильные параметры запуска. Проверьте состояние через «services.msc» и запустите их в автоматическом режиме.
- Правила безопасности локальной сети и домена. В некоторых случаях, особенно в домашних или малых офисных сетях без домена, отсутствуют настройки безопасности, что также может препятствовать обнаружению. Убедитесь, что все устройства находятся в одной рабочей группе и используют одинаковые сетевые учетные записи без конфликтов в именах и разрешениях.
- Сбои в работе протокола NetBIOS. Этот протокол обеспечивает преобразование сетевых имен компьютеров в IP-адреса. Если он отключён в свойствах IPv4 сети, то другие компьютеры просто не будут отображаться. Для проверки откройте свойства сетевого подключения, выберите IPv4, «Свойства» > «Дополнительно» > вкладку «WINS» и включите NetBIOS через TCP/IP.
Практические решения проблемы
- Проверка сетевого профиля и активация сетевого обнаружения: Откройте Центр управления сетями и общим доступом > «Изменить дополнительные параметры общего доступа». Выберите профиль «Домашняя» или «Рабочая» и включите сетевое обнаружение и общий доступ к файлам.
- Настройка службы и компонентов: Запустите командную строку с правами администратора и выполните команду
services.msc. Найдите службы «Публикация ресурсов обнаружения функций» и «Узел обнаружения функций», и установите для них тип запуска «Автоматически». - Проверка и активация SMB-протоколов: Зайдите в «Программы и компоненты» > «Включение или отключение компонентов Windows». Убедитесь, что включены «Поддержка SMB 1.0/CIFS» и связанные службы.
- Настройка брандмауэра: В параметрах безопасности разрешите входящие подключения для протоколов и служб, отвечающих за сетевое обнаружение. Также стоит проверить настройки сторонних антивирусов, которые могут блокировать сетевые порты.
- Диагностика с помощью пинга и адресации: Запустите команду
ping IP-адрес_компьютера_в_сетидля проверки связи. Если пинг не проходит, возможно проблема в сетевой конфигурации или есть физические преграды (кабели, роутеры).
Настройка сетевого обнаружения и общего доступа в Windows 7 для видимости компьютеров
Рассмотрим пошагово, как выполнить настройку, чтобы устранить проблему, когда Windows 7 не видит сетевой компьютер.
Включение сетевого обнаружения
Для начала, необходимо убедиться, что в системе включено сетевое обнаружение. Эта функция отвечает за обнаружение других устройств в локальной сети и уведомление сети о вашем компьютере.
- Откройте Панель управления и перейдите в раздел Центр управления сетями и общим доступом.
- В левой части окна выберите Изменить дополнительные параметры общего доступа.
- Выберите активный профиль сети (дома или рабочего места). Это важно, так как для публичной сети обнаружение по умолчанию отключено.
- Включите параметр Включить сетевое обнаружение.
- Активируйте также Включить общий доступ к файлам и принтерам, если хотите предоставить доступ к ресурсам вашего компьютера.
- Нажмите Сохранить изменения.
Эти действия часто помогают решить проблему, когда Windows 7 не видит других компьютеров. При этом важно, чтобы все устройства в сети были подключены к одному рабочему или домашнему профилю, иначе обнаружение будет ограничено.
Настройка общего доступа с защитой паролем
Если после включения сетевого обнаружения Windows 7 не видит компьютеры или не отображает общие папки, обратите внимание на параметры защиты общего доступа.
- Вернитесь в Центр управления сетями и общим доступом и снова откройте Изменить дополнительные параметры общего доступа.
- В разделе текущего профиля найдите блок Общий доступ с защитой паролем.
- Если вы хотите упростить доступ и не использовать учетные записи с паролями, выберите Отключить общий доступ с защитой паролем.
- Если безопасность важна, оставьте этот параметр включённым, но проверьте, что учетные записи на каждом сетевом компьютере корректно настроены и известны пользователям.
- Сохраните изменения.
При отключённой защите паролем Windows 7 может свободно видеть сетевые компьютеры и получать доступ к общим ресурсам без запросов на ввод учётных данных. Однако в корпоративной сети такой подход не рекомендуется из соображений безопасности.
Проверка службы обнаружения SSDP и функции 'Обнаружение по сети'
Иногда причина, почему Windows 7 не видит других компьютеров, кроется в остановленных или некорректно работающих службах системы.
- Откройте Службы через Выполнить (клавиши Win+R) и введите
services.msc. - Найдите службу Обнаружение SSDP (SSDP Discovery) и убедитесь, что её тип запуска установлен на Авто, а состояние – Работает. Если служба остановлена, запустите её.
- Аналогично проверьте службу Обнаружение функций сетевого расположения (Function Discovery Resource Publication). Она отвечает за публикацию вашего компьютера в сети для других устройств.
Если эти службы отключены, Windows 7 не сможет эффективно обнаруживать и показывать другие сетевые устройства или сделать ваш компьютер видимым в локальной сети.
Настройка общего доступа к конкретным папкам
Для того, чтобы ваш компьютер с Windows 7 был доступен для других устройств, стоит правильно настроить общий доступ к папкам.
- Перейдите в Проводник, выберите папку, которую хотите сделать доступной в сети.
- Щёлкните по ней правой кнопкой мыши и выберите Общий доступ и безопасность.
- В открывшемся окне установите флажок Открыть общий доступ к этой папке.
- Используйте кнопку Разрешения, чтобы назначить права: чтение, изменение или полный доступ для пользователей сети.
- Нажмите ОК и примените настройки.
После этого другим компьютерам в сети будет доступен просмотр и работа с этой папкой, если и у них включено сетевое обнаружение и общий доступ.
Влияние параметров брандмауэра и антивируса на видимость сетевых устройств в Windows 7
Антивирусные пакеты, помимо защиты от вирусов, часто включают собственные средства защитного экрана, которые дополняют или полностью заменяют стандартный брандмауэр Windows. Их настройки могут блокировать сетевой трафик, требующийся для обнаружения компьютеров в локальной сети. Без правильной настройки исключений появляется эффект, когда Windows 7 не видит компьютеры в сети вообще или видит их не полностью.
Основные настройки брандмауэра Windows 7, влияющие на видимость в сети
Для нормальной работы сетевого обнаружения рекомендуется убедиться, что в параметрах брандмауэра включена соответствующая служба и разрешен трафик для сетей с заданным профилем (домашняя, рабочая или общественная сеть). Если профиль стоит «Общественная сеть», Windows 7 будет максимально ограничивать обнаружение других компьютеров.
- Включите сетевое обнаружение и общий доступ к файлам и принтерам: это можно сделать в разделе 'Центр управления сетями и общим доступом', где параметры общего доступа должны быть выставлены переключателем в положение 'Включить'.
- Проверьте разрешения в брандмауэре: в «Дополнительных параметрах» брандмауэра Windows убедитесь, что правила для «Обнаружение сети» и «Общий доступ к файлам и принтерам» активированы для вашего сетевого профиля.
Если эти параметры отключены, Windows 7 не видит компьютеры в сети, поскольку изолирует ПК даже при физически исправном соединении.
Влияние антивирусных программ и их защитных модулей
Современные антивирусы зачастую имеют встроенный модуль сетевого экрана, который фильтрует почти весь трафик кроме стандартных HTTP и HTTPS. В результате, Windows 7 не видит других компьютеров, так как необходимые порты и протоколы блокируются.
Для решения проблемы рекомендую временно отключить антивирус и проверить, появляется ли возможность обнаружения других устройств. Если после отключения антивируса компьютеры стали видны, значит именно его настройки мешают работе сети.
- Откройте настройки антивируса и найдите раздел сетевых настроек или межсетевого экрана.
- Добавьте в исключения протоколы и службы, связанные с сетевым обнаружением, такие как SSDP (port 1900 UDP), NetBIOS (ports 137–139 TCP/UDP) и SMB (port 445 TCP).
- Активируйте доверие к локальной сети, установите для нее доверенный профиль в антивирусе.
В случае, если такая тонкая настройка невозможна, можно разрешить работу брандмауэра Windows и ограничить использование стороннего защитного экрана только необходимыми компонентами.
Практические рекомендации и советы
- Для тестирования сети используйте команду ping с IP-адресами других компьютеров, чтобы проверить, оказывают ли брандмауэр или антивирус влияние именно на сетевое обнаружение.
- Обратите внимание на профили сетей в Windows 7 – переключение с «Общественной» на «Рабочую» или «Домашнюю» сеть значительно расширит доступность устройств.
- Иногда помогает полный сброс брандмауэра командой netsh advfirewall reset из командной строки с правами администратора, после которой настройки восстанавливаются к стандартным.
- Проверьте, что служба «Публикация ресурсов обнаружения SSDP» и «Служба обнаружения функций» запущены – их блокировка влияет на видимость сетевых компьютеров.